“Reclaim your emotional well-being, supercharge your self-empowerment, and create a magical life of miracles through the healing power of letter writing…”

Discover how an advanced form of journaling known as secret letter writing can help you become more positive and empowered in your life. 
Whether the letter is for your eyes only or shared with another, this emotional release and manifesting tool has the power to transform your sense of self and your relationship with difficult circumstances to embrace positive outcomes and opportunities. 
The Secret Letters Project is a practical and inspiring resource containing instructions and examples of 20 types of letters to write for various circumstances in your life, to help with things such as; dealing with grief, resolving resentments, releasing emotions and expressing yourself safely, asking for or offering forgiveness, uncovering answers, starting your life over or moving on from the past, providing clarity and closure, declaring your desires and intentions, aiding recovery from illness or addictions, giving gratitude, and expressing excitement and anticipation for what the future may hold. 
No matter what challenges, choices, or opportunities you are facing, a hand-written letter from the heart can help.

In less than 3 months my brand new Young Adult paranormal series, THE DELTA GIRLS, will be launched!

Beginning with SIGHT, the series follows five sisters who can each glimpse the future with one of the five senses. Each instalment will be released three months apart (following SIGHT on July 14 will be SOUND, SCENT, TASTE, and TOUCH). The series is published by Diversion Books and will be available in both ebook and paperback.
